Abstract
Moscow city. A rally at the Central Aerodrome dedicated to the opening of the II All-Union rally of the winners of the tourist campaign of Komsomol members and youth in the places of revolutionary, military and labor glory of the Soviet people. Speakers: I. Konev, V. Kazakov, A. Chesnavichus. Meeting of the rally participants in the village of Petrishchevo, Vereisky District, Moscow Region. Laying a wreath at the monument to Z. Kosmodemyanskaya, laying a park named after the 40th anniversary of the Komsomol. A rally at the monument to the Panfilov heroes at the Dubosekovo junction in the Volokolamsk district of the Moscow region. Speakers: V. I. Kazakov, former commissar of the Panfilov division P. V. Logvinenko, one of the surviving Panfilov men I. Shchadrin. Rally on Red Square to mark the closing of the rally. Youth representatives lay wreaths at the Lenin Mausoleum. First Secretary of the Komsomol Central Committee S.P. Pavlov speaking. Participants of the rally, troops of the Moscow Military District, veterans of the Great Patriotic War are walking along Red Square. On the podium of the Lenin Mausoleum, the leaders of the CPSU, the Soviet state, foreign guests; among them - A.I. Mikoyan.
